Klangs are an enemy in Grunty Industries of Banjo-Tooie. They disguise themselves as an oil drum to trick Banjo and Kazooie. Their disguises, however, are less than perfect since they stay somewhat distanced from actual barrels. A Klang will spring to life when Banjo and Kazooie get near it and will attack by trying to bump the bear and bird.

If a Klang has a Toxi-Gag inside of it, it is considered a Toxi-Klang. It is also condisidered a Toxi-Klang when it has toxic waste dripping out from its lid.
